  3. One of the award-winning museums within the Ironbridge Valley of Invention, managed by the Ironbridge Gorge museum Trust. Discover how British tile designers fashioned our world at Jackfield Tile Museum. Experience some of the most beautiful tiles in the world, including designs by famous artists. Discover where natural resources met amazing skills, artistry and craft in a 19th-century creative hub. Explore galleries and room settings (Edwardian Tube Station, butchers and church) filled with tiles you can touch. See tiles by Salvador Dali and William Morris and Victorian tiles in an original, working factory. Take part in tile decorating workshops throughout school holiday periods (additional costs apply) and create designs of your own.
